The 50th Anniversary of the Battle of Long Tan in Vietnam in 1966 was Commemorated in Canberra on Long Tan Day - 18Aug2016. The Ceremony was complemented by Flypasts of aircraft relevant to the Australian and US participation in the Vietnam War. Aircraft which participated in the Flypasts were an RAAF C-130J-30, two C-47s, two Caribou, a Cessna O-2, a Bell UH-1H ‘Huey’ and a Bell 47G-3B1 Sioux, followed by two USAF B-52Hs from Guam. The Formation leader, HARS C-47B Skytrain VH-EAF (ex RAAF A65-94) Cn 16358, banks to Stbd after the second pass over the Ceremony on Anzac Parade.
